Historic Step from China: Jetank Swarm Carrier Drone Unveiled

China has once again showcased its rapid advancements in the defense industry by introducing the Jetank “swarm carrier” un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V), capable of launching small drone swarms from high altitudes, dropping bombs, and carrying missiles.

Jetank’s Technical Specifications and Capabilities

Unveiled at the Zhuhai Air Show 2024, Jetank stood out with its remarkable technical features:

  • Maximum Takeoff Weight: 16 tons
  • Payload Capacity: 6 tons
  • Wingspan: 25 meters

According to Global Times, Jetank is defined as a next-generation large UAV platform, equipped to carry a wide range of weapons and equipment similar to modern combat aircraft.

Advanced Technological Features

Jetank is not just a combat vehicle but is hailed as a technological marvel with revolutionary capabilities:

  • Drone Swarm Deployment: Its ability to release small drone swarms from high altitudes is considered a game-changer on the battlefield.
  • Radar System and Electro-Optical Section: Located in its nose, these systems provide situational awareness and advanced target detection.
  • Satellite Connectivity and Remote Control: Jetank can be flexibly operated remotely, ensuring versatility in combat scenarios.

Chinese military aviation expert Fu Qianshao emphasized that these features make Jetank an indispensable asset on the battlefield.

Zhuhai Air Show 2024: A Platform Showcasing China’s Strength

The Zhuhai Air Show 2024 served as a stage for China to demonstrate its breakthroughs in military aviation and defense technologies. Alongside Jetank, other notable equipment introduced included:

  • J-35A Stealth Fighter Jet and its larger version, the J-20 Stealth Fighter Jet
  • CH-7 Stealth Drone
  • HQ-19 Air Defense System
  • J-15 Naval Fighter Jet Electronic Warfare Variant

Strategic Message: Emphasis on Peace, Not Power Display

In an editorial by Global Times, it was stated that China’s aim with this showcase was “not to flaunt power, but to reaffirm its commitment to protecting national sovereignty and promoting peace-driven development.”

China also hosted high-level delegations from Saudi Arabia and Russia, highlighting its international cooperation efforts and diplomatic influence.
